import {CommonModule} from '@angular/common';
import {Component, Directive, EventEmitter, Input, OnDestroy, Output, ViewChild} from '@angular/core';
import {TestBed} from '@angular/core/testing';
describe('outputs', () => {
@Component({selector: 'button-toggle', template: ''})
class ButtonToggle {
@Output('change') change = new EventEmitter();
@Output('reset') resetStream = new EventEmitter();
}
@Directive({selector: '[otherDir]'})
class OtherDir {
@Output('change') changeStream = new EventEmitter();
}
@Component({selector: 'destroy-comp', template: ''})
class DestroyComp implements OnDestroy {
events: string[] = [];
ngOnDestroy() {
this.events.push('destroy');
}
}
@Directive({selector: '[myButton]'})
class MyButton {
@Output() click = new EventEmitter();
}
it('should call component output function when event is emitted', () => {
let counter = 0;
@Component({template: '<button-toggle (change)="onChange()"></button-toggle>'})
class App {
@ViewChild(ButtonToggle) buttonToggle!: ButtonToggle;
onChange() {
counter++;
}
}
TestBed.configureTestingModule({declarations: [App, ButtonToggle]});
const fixture = TestBed.createComponent(App);
fixture.detectChanges();
fixture.componentInstance.bu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(counter).toBe(1);
fixture.componentInstance.bu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(counter).toBe(2);
});
it('should support more than 1 output function on the same node', () => {
let counter = 0;
let resetCounter = 0;
@Component(
{template: '<button-toggle (change)="onChange()" (reset)="onReset()"></button-toggle>'})
class App {
@ViewChild(ButtonToggle) buttonToggle!: ButtonToggle;
onChange() {
counter++;
}
onReset() {
resetCounter++;
}
}
TestBed.configureTestingModule({declarations: [App, ButtonToggle]});
const fixture = TestBed.createComponent(App);
fixture.detectChanges();
fixture.componentInstance.bu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(counter).toBe(1);
fixture.componentInstance.buttonToggle.resetStream.next();
expect(resetCounter).toBe(1);
});
it('should eval component output expression when event is emitted', () => {
@Component({template: '<button-toggle (change)="counter = counter + 1"></button-toggle>'})
class App {
@ViewChild(ButtonToggle) buttonToggle!: ButtonToggle;
counter = 0;
}
TestBed.configureTestingModule({declarations: [App, ButtonToggle]});
const fixture = TestBed.createComponent(App);
fixture.detectChanges();
fixture.componentInstance.bu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(fixture.componentInstance.counter).toBe(1);
fixture.componentInstance.bu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(fixture.componentInstance.counter).toBe(2);
});
it('should unsubscribe from output when view is destroyed', () => {
let counter = 0;
@Component(
{template: '<button-toggle *ngIf="condition" (change)="onChange()"></button-toggle>'})
class App {
@ViewChild(ButtonToggle) buttonToggle!: ButtonToggle;
condition = true;
onChange() {
counter++;
}
}
TestBed.configureTestingModule({imports: [CommonModule], declarations: [App, ButtonToggle]});
const fixture = TestBed.createComponent(App);
fixture.detectChanges();
const buttonToggle = fixture.componentInstance.buttonToggle;
bu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(counter).toBe(1);
fixture.componentInstance.condition = false;
fixture.detectChanges();
bu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(counter).toBe(1);
});
it('should unsubscribe from output in nested view', () => {
let counter = 0;
@Component({
template: `
<div *ngIf="condition">
<button-toggle *ngIf="condition2" (change)="onChange()"></button-toggle>
</div>
`
})
class App {
@ViewChild(ButtonToggle) buttonToggle!: ButtonToggle;
condition = true;
condition2 = true;
onChange() {
counter++;
}
}
TestBed.configureTestingModule({imports: [CommonModule], declarations: [App, ButtonToggle]});
const fixture = TestBed.createComponent(App);
fixture.detectChanges();
const buttonToggle = fixture.componentInstance.buttonToggle;
bu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(counter).toBe(1);
fixture.componentInstance.condition = false;
fixture.detectChanges();
bu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(counter).toBe(1);
});
it('should work properly when view also has listeners and destroys', () => {
let clickCounter = 0;
let changeCounter = 0;
@Component({
template: `
<div *ngIf="condition">
<button (click)="onClick()">Click me</button>
<button-toggle (change)="onChange()"></button-toggle>
<destroy-comp></destroy-comp>
</div>
`
})
class App {
@ViewChild(ButtonToggle) buttonToggle!: ButtonToggle;
@ViewChild(DestroyComp) destroyComp!: DestroyComp;
condition = true;
onClick() {
clickCounter++;
}
onChange() {
changeCounter++;
}
}
TestBed.configureTestingModule(
{imports: [CommonModule], declarations: [App, ButtonToggle, DestroyComp]});
const fixture = TestBed.createComponent(App);
fixture.detectChanges();
const {buttonToggle, destroyComp} = fixture.componentInstance;
const button: HTMLButtonElement = fixture.nativeElement.querySelector('button');
bu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(changeCounter).toBe(1);
expect(clickCounter).toBe(0);
button.click();
expect(changeCounter).toBe(1);
expect(clickCounter).toBe(1);
fixture.componentInstance.condition = false;
fixture.detectChanges();
expect(destroyComp.events).toEqual(['destroy']);
buttonToggle.change.next();
button.click();
expect(changeCounter).toBe(1);
expect(clickCounter).toBe(1);
});
it('should fire event listeners along with outputs if they match', () => {
let counter = 0;
@Component({template: '<button myButton (click)="onClick()">Click me</button>'})
class App {
@ViewChild(MyButton) buttonDir!: MyButton;
onClick() {
counter++;
}
}
TestBed.configureTestingModule({declarations: [App, MyButton]});
const fixture = TestBed.createComponent(App);
fixture.detectChanges();
// To match current Angular behavior, the click listener is still
// set up in addition to any matching outputs.
const button = fixture.nativeElement.querySelector('button');
button.click();
expect(counter).toBe(1);
fixture.componentInstance.buttonDir.click.next();
expect(counter).toBe(2);
});
it('should work with two outputs of the same name', () => {
let counter = 0;
@Component({template: '<button-toggle (change)="onChange()" otherDir></button-toggle>'})
class App {
@ViewChild(ButtonToggle) buttonToggle!: ButtonToggle;
@ViewChild(OtherDir) otherDir!: OtherDir;
onChange() {
counter++;
}
}
TestBed.configureTestingModule({declarations: [App, ButtonToggle, OtherDir]});
const fixture = TestBed.createComponent(App);
fixture.detectChanges();
fixture.componentInstance.bu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(counter).toBe(1);
fixture.componentInstance.otherDir.changeStream.next();
expect(counter).toBe(2);
});
it('should work with an input and output of the same name', () => {
let counter = 0;
@Directive({selector: '[otherChangeDir]'})
class OtherChangeDir {
@Input() change!: boolean;
}
@Component({
template:
'<button-toggle (change)="onChange()" otherChangeDir [change]="change"></button-toggle>'
})
class App {
@ViewChild(ButtonToggle) buttonToggle!: ButtonToggle;
@ViewChild(OtherChangeDir) otherDir!: OtherChangeDir;
change = true;
onChange() {
counter++;
}
}
TestBed.configureTestingModule({declarations: [App, ButtonToggle, OtherChangeDir]});
const fixture = TestBed.createComponent(App);
fixture.detectChanges();
const {buttonToggle, otherDir} = fixture.componentInstance;
expect(otherDir.change).toBe(true);
fixture.componentInstance.change = false;
fixture.detectChanges();
expect(otherDir.change).toBe(false);
buttonToggle.change.next();
expect(counter).toBe(1);
});
});
